Course Details
• Introduction to Energy Advocacy: Understanding the role of energy advocacy, key players, and its importance in today's world.
• Energy Policies and Regulations: A comprehensive overview of national and international energy policies and regulations.
• Renewable Energy Technologies: Exploring various renewable energy technologies and their impact on the global energy landscape.
• Energy Efficiency and Conservation: Best practices and strategies for energy efficiency and conservation.
• Climate Change and Energy: The relationship between climate change and energy production, and the role of advocacy in addressing this challenge.
• Energy Access and Equity: Ensuring energy access for all, and promoting energy equity and justice.
• Stakeholder Engagement and Communication: Effective strategies for engaging and communicating with stakeholders, policymakers, and the public.
• Monitoring and Evaluation: Techniques for monitoring and evaluating energy advocacy efforts, and measuring their impact.
• Future of Energy Advocacy: Emerging trends and opportunities in energy advocacy, and how to prepare for the future.
Note: These units are designed to provide a comprehensive overview of energy advocacy, and can be tailored to meet the needs of different audiences and contexts.
